Stocks to Watch Today, March 19: Markets are set for an active session as several companies feature in Stocks to Watch Today, driven by key corporate developments and regulatory updates. JSW Steel, Axis Bank, and Nazara Technologies lead the news flow with expansion, funding, and acquisition announcements, while Delta Corp and PhysicsWallah face tax-related developments.

Godrej Properties
Acquires 20 Acres in Bengaluru for Rs 1,350 Cr Project
Godrej Properties has acquired 20 acres of land in Bengaluru to develop a housing project with estimated revenue of Rs 1,350 crore.
JSW Steel
AP Govt Clears 424 Acres for Kadapa Steel Plant
The Andhra Pradesh government approved allocation of over 424 acres in Kadapa district for JSW Steel’s integrated plant project.
Mazagon Dock Shipbuilders
USD 39 Million Vessel Contract Secured from SCI
The company has signed a contract with Shipping Corporation of India to build a 3,000 DWT methanol dual-fuel platform supply vessel.
Nazara Technologies
UK Arm to Acquire 50 per cent Stake in Spanish Gaming Firms
Nazara’s UK subsidiary will acquire a controlling stake in Bluetile Games and BestPlay Systems for USD 100.3 million.
Delhivery
Expands International Air Parcel Service to 3 Countries
Delhivery has extended its economy air parcel service to the UK, Canada, and Australia.
Zydus Lifesciences, Torrent Pharma
Partner to Co-Market Diabetes Drug in India
The companies have entered a licensing and supply agreement for Semaglutide Injection in the Indian market.
Amara Raja Energy & Mobility
Enters Defence Electronics with Indigenous Naval Tech
Its R&D arm has developed a Power Conditioning Cabinet for naval sonar systems, marking entry into defence electronics.
Delta Corp
Faces Rs 1,752 Cr Tax Demand Notice from Goa Authorities
Delta Corp and its subsidiary received tax notices citing alleged shortfall for FY2022–23, including penalties and interest.
PhysicsWallah
Rs 263 Cr Tax Demand Raised by IT Department
The Income Tax Department has issued a demand notice treating certain investments as taxable income for AY 2023–24.
